With the bestseller Cook It in Cast Iron by Cook’s Country and The Lodge Cast Iron Cookbook by The Lodge Company, which has sold over 50k copies, this old fashioned cookware is becoming trendy once again. Megan has 26k Facebook followers and has been featured on many popular food blogs such as The Pioneer Woman and Simply Recipes.This book includes 80 recipes and 80 photos.. With one-pot meals and recipes that can be made in 30 minutes or less, you will be amazed by the meals you can produce with such little time and effort. She showcases the unique, all-purpose nature of cast iron with recipes like Gorgonzola and Herb Skillet Grilled Strip Steak, Summer Vegetable Baked Polenta with Eggs, Czech Slow Roasted Pork Shoulder, Rosemary Focaccia, No Pit Hawaiian Kalua Pork, Bacon Wrapped Filet Mignon and Sweet Potato with Glazed Coconut Pecan Crust. Megan Keno, creator of the blog Country Cleaver, has created recipes that combine convenience, gourmet flavors and the popular trend of traditional cooking. In Cast Iron Gourmet, Megan shows that you don’t need dozens of dishes or tons of time in order to create gourmet meals
